Kiến trúc YOLOv8: Tiến bộ và Ứng dụng trong Phân loại Hình ảnh

3
(218 votes)

Kiến trúc YOLOv8 là một bước tiến quan trọng trong lĩnh vực thị giác máy tính, mang lại nhiều cải tiến về độ chính xác và tốc độ xử lý. Bài viết này sẽ giới thiệu về YOLOv8, cải tiến của nó so với các phiên bản trước, và ứng dụng của nó trong phân loại hình ảnh.

YOLOv8 là gì?

YOLOv8, hay You Only Look Once version 8, là một mô hình phát hiện đối tượng trong lĩnh vực thị giác máy tính. YOLOv8 là phiên bản mới nhất của dòng mô hình YOLO, được phát triển bởi Alexey Bochkovskiy. Mô hình này được thiết kế để phát hiện đối tượng trong hình ảnh và video với độ chính xác cao và tốc độ nhanh.

Cải tiến chính của YOLOv8 so với các phiên bản trước là gì?

YOLOv8 mang lại nhiều cải tiến so với các phiên bản trước. Đầu tiên, nó sử dụng một kiến trúc mới gọi là CSPDarknet53-PANet-DeepSORT, giúp tăng cường khả năng phát hiện và theo dõi đối tượng. Thứ hai, YOLOv8 cải thiện độ chính xác bằng cách sử dụng kỹ thuật augmentation hình ảnh mới. Cuối cùng, YOLOv8 cũng tối ưu hóa tốc độ xử lý, giúp nó phù hợp hơn với các ứng dụng thời gian thực.

YOLOv8 được ứng dụng trong lĩnh vực nào?

YOLOv8 được ứng dụng rộng rãi trong nhiều lĩnh vực như an ninh, giám sát, tự động hóa công nghiệp, và xe tự lái. Trong an ninh và giám sát, YOLOv8 giúp phát hiện và theo dõi đối tượng nhanh chóng. Trong tự động hóa công nghiệp, nó giúp nhận biết và phân loại các sản phẩm trên dây chuyền sản xuất. Trong xe tự lái, YOLOv8 giúp phát hiện và phân loại các đối tượng trên đường, như người đi bộ, xe cộ, và biển báo.

Lợi ích của việc sử dụng YOLOv8 trong phân loại hình ảnh là gì?

YOLOv8 mang lại nhiều lợi ích trong phân loại hình ảnh. Đầu tiên, nó cung cấp độ chính xác cao, giúp phân loại hình ảnh một cách chính xác. Thứ hai, YOLOv8 có tốc độ xử lý nhanh, giúp phân loại hình ảnh trong thời gian thực. Cuối cùng, YOLOv8 có khả năng phát hiện nhiều đối tượng cùng một lúc, giúp phân loại hình ảnh phức tạp.

Cách sử dụng YOLOv8 trong phân loại hình ảnh như thế nào?

Để sử dụng YOLOv8 trong phân loại hình ảnh, bạn cần huấn luyện mô hình với tập dữ liệu hình ảnh của mình. Sau khi huấn luyện, bạn có thể sử dụng mô hình để phân loại hình ảnh mới. YOLOv8 sẽ phát hiện các đối tượng trong hình ảnh, gán nhãn cho chúng, và trả về kết quả phân loại.

YOLOv8 là một công cụ mạnh mẽ cho phân loại hình ảnh, với độ chính xác cao và tốc độ xử lý nhanh. Nó được ứng dụng rộng rãi trong nhiều lĩnh vực, từ an ninh, giám sát, đến tự động hóa công nghiệp và xe tự lái. Với sự tiến bộ của YOLOv8, chúng ta có thể mong đợi nhiều ứng dụng thú vị và hữu ích hơn nữa trong tương lai.